Plasmin (PLM), via activation from plasminogen (PLG), not only exerts fibrinolysis and thrombolysis effects, but also involves in extensive physical processes such as embryonic development, tissue remodeling and wound healing. Moreover, recent studies showed a tough association between PLM with inflammation, autoimmunity, malignancy and neural degeneration. Furthermore, more than ten plasminogen receptors and binding proteins have been discovered on cellular surface. Here, we review the researching progresses on the structures, signal transduction and pathogenic mechanisms of these receptors and binding proteins, so as to provide clues for better understanding on fibrinolysis system and for developing new diagnostic and therapeutic pathways.
